I've been looking for something that will make a bard better, and was wondering if anyone had any sorts of homebrew (or alternate class I am unaware of) for either PF or 3.5 for a Bard who can attack using his perform skill. I've seen a few failed attempts at such things (one of them was a base class that basically allowed 1d2 damage a round, and another could kill everything with a strum)

So any good combat capable bards in this vein? If not I'll just get to work on making my own.

Lyric Thaumaturge [CMage] gains an ability to use Songs to add Sonic damage to spells. Seeker of the Song [CArc] mostly attacks with songs and Virtuoso [CArc] has some such abilities too. Most of them suck tho. Still, they're all Bard-based PrCs so they should sorta work.

Don't even need to refluff, there are feats (Draconic Heritage and its ilk from Dragon Magic) and a ritual (Rite of Draconic Affinity, Races of the Dragon) that allow just this mechanic.

There's also the Crystal Echoblade from MiC that does half bard level in sonic damage on a hit, a number of sonic themed spells from SpC, etc, etc.
